House Removal Questions
What types of properties are suitable for house removal services? House removal services typically handle a variety of property types, including single-family homes, apartments, and condominiums in Morris County and nearby areas.
What items are usually included in house removals? Services generally include furniture, appliances, boxes, and personal belongings, with options for specialty items like pianos or large artwork.
Are there restrictions on what can be moved? Certain items such as hazardous materials, perishable goods, or illegal substances are not permitted to be moved during house removals.
What should homeowners do to prepare for a house removal? Clearing pathways, disassembling large furniture, and organizing belongings can help facilitate a smoother moving process.
